Lore Origins: Canonical Late-Night Encounters

In the official Ben 10 series, the characters frequently deal with sleep-related conflicts that serve as the foundation for these fan interpretations:

"Midnight Madness": Ben is hypnotized by the villain Sublimino, leading to a series of sleepwalking incidents where he unknowingly uses his alien forms to commit crimes while Gwen and Max try to stop him.

"Pleasant Dreams": Ben experiences nightmares that cause him to transform into "Benwolf" while sleepwalking, forcing Gwen to intervene to prevent him from harming others.

The Rustbucket Dynamic: Much of the original series takes place in Grandpa Max's RV, where the close quarters often led to late-night bickering or moments of mutual support during long road trips. Fanfiction and Community Interpretation
